Your mission
- Support the site based commercial team to generate cost reports on a monthly and quarterly basis.
- Interact and collaborate with other Company staff in the head office and on site.
- Maintain strict confidentiality and discretion on all information associated with employee details.
- Reporting of KPI's.
- Completing the site resource tracker each week.
- General filing (on cloud) and office duties.
- Soft copy file management.
- Record Keeping.
- Assisting managers with clerical duties.
- Generating and managing statistics of site works.
- Experience of MS Excel essential.
- Other adhoc duties as required.
- Processing of goods received documents.
- Reporting to Site Project Manager.
- Strong interpersonal skills and ability to communicate within a multi-disciplinary site team.
- At least 2 years' experience in a fast paced similar role.
- Strong IT experience with Microsoft office skills and pdf software tools.
- Ability to use time productively, maximise efficiency, and strong time management skills.
- Knowledge of COINS software is advantageous (training can be provided).
- Knowledge of snagging related to construction would be a benefit, but is not essential.
